Canyon Capital Advisors's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2026, Canyon Capital Advisors held 27 positions worth $882M, up 14% from $772M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 86% of the portfolio.
Canyon Capital Advisors withdrew a net $54.3M in Q2 2026, closing 5 positions and reducing 8 holdings. Its most notable exit was First Foundation Inc, an estimated $48.1M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Real Estate at 49% of assets, up from 45%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.
Against the trend, Canyon Capital Advisors opened a new position in FirstSun Capital Bancorp worth $74.9M.
